BRZE Overview and Recent Performance

Braze operates a cloud-based customer engagement platform that enables brands to orchestrate personalized, cross-channel marketing campaigns across email, push notifications, in-app messaging, SMS, and newer channels like RCS (Rich Communication Services). The company serves over 2,600 customers globally and has processed more than 100 billion messages during peak periods such as Cyber Week, demonstrating the scale of its platform.

In recent quarters, Braze has delivered a steady stream of revenue beats. Its most recently reported quarterly results showed revenue of approximately $205 million, representing year-over-year growth near 28%. Organic growth has remained robust in the low-to-mid 20% range. The company's dollar-based net retention rate, a key metric measuring expansion within existing customer accounts, has stabilized around 108% to 109%. Perhaps most notably, Braze has now posted multiple consecutive quarters of non-GAAP (non-Generally Accepted Accounting Principles) operating income, signaling a transition toward sustainable profitability. The launch of its AI Decisioning Agent, bolstered by the acquisition of OfferFit, has opened new monetization avenues, with management projecting roughly 2% of annual revenue growth attributable to AI products. Analysts from firms including Mizuho, Needham, Barclays, and BTIG have maintained bullish ratings, with price targets ranging from the high $30s to $68 per share.

CRM Overview and Recent Performance

Salesforce is the world's largest CRM software provider, offering a comprehensive suite of cloud-based applications spanning sales, service, marketing, commerce, analytics, and integration via its MuleSoft platform. With annual revenue exceeding $41 billion and a market capitalization well above $140 billion, the company serves enterprises of virtually every size across every major industry.

Recent financial results reflect a business delivering consistent, albeit single-digit, revenue growth alongside expanding margins. In its most recently reported quarters, Salesforce generated revenue of roughly $10.2–10.3 billion per quarter, with year-over-year growth of 9% to 10%. GAAP operating margins have climbed above 21%, while non-GAAP operating margins have reached approximately 34% to 35%, representing the tenth consecutive quarter of margin expansion. The company's remaining performance obligation, a measure of contracted future revenue, stood at nearly $60 billion, indicating strong forward visibility. The standout story, however, has been the rapid adoption of Agentforce, Salesforce's agentic AI platform. Since its launch, Agentforce has closed over 18,500 deals—more than 9,500 of them paid—and has processed over 3.2 trillion tokens. Data Cloud and AI annual recurring revenue reached nearly $1.4 billion, growing 114% year-over-year. The company has also returned billions to shareholders through an expanded $50 billion share repurchase authorization and regular dividend payments.

Head-to-Head Comparison

The most striking contrast between BRZE and CRM lies in their growth profiles and scale. Braze is growing revenue at roughly 25% to 28% annually—roughly three times the pace of Salesforce—but from a far smaller base. Salesforce, by contrast, compounds a massive revenue stream at high-single-digit to low-double-digit rates while converting roughly one-third of each revenue dollar into non-GAAP operating profit. This scale advantage translates directly into vastly superior free cash flow generation, which Salesforce uses for aggressive share buybacks and dividends—capital return mechanisms Braze does not yet offer.

On the AI front, both companies are making substantial bets. Salesforce has placed Agentforce at the center of its strategy, aiming to reach $60 billion in annual revenue by fiscal 2030. Braze has taken a more focused approach, embedding AI-driven decisioning and agentic messaging capabilities directly into its customer engagement platform. While both approaches carry execution risk, Salesforce has the advantage of a massive installed base for cross-selling, whereas Braze benefits from being a more agile innovator in a narrower domain.

Sector exposure and market sentiment reveal another dimension. Both companies are sensitive to enterprise IT (Information Technology) spending cycles, but Salesforce's sheer size and diversification across industries provide a degree of insulation. Braze, being smaller and more concentrated in digital-first brands, may experience more pronounced swings tied to marketing budget trends. Analyst consensus for both stocks leans positive, though Braze's average price target implies a larger potential upside from recent trading levels, reflecting its higher-beta, higher-reward profile.

Industries' Descriptions

@Packaged Software (-4.81% weekly)

Packaged software comprises multiple software programs bundled together and sold as a group. For example, Microsoft Office includes multiple applications such as Excel, Word, and PowerPoint. In some cases, buying a bundled product is cheaper than purchasing each item individually[s20] . Microsoft Corporation, Oracle Corp. and Adobe are some major American packaged software makers.
